Synthesis and crystal structure of 2,4,6-tri(. cap alpha. ,. cap alpha. -dimethylbenzyl)phenol

2,4,6-Tri(..cap alpha..,..cap alpha..-dimethylbenzyl)phenol (I) is an effective antioxidant additive for polymeric materials and can be used for the production of functional derivatives of ..cap alpha..,..cap alpha..-dimethylbenzylphenols. The aim of work was to study the production of (I) in the presence of aluminum phenolate as the most selective catalyst in the synthesis of ..cap alpha..,..cap alpha..-dimethylbenzylphenols and to investigate the steric and electronic effects of ..cap alpha..-methylstyrene substituents on the molecular geometry of (I). The optimum conditions were determined for the production of 2,4,6-tri(..cap alpha..,..cap alpha..-dimethylbenzyl)phenol by the alkylation of phenol with ..cap alpha..-methylstyrene. It was established that the intramolecular distances and the distributions of the bond lengths and bond angles of the phenol ring are similar in the molecules of 2,4,6-tri-(..cap alpha..,..cap alpha..-dimethylbenzene)phenol and 2,6-di-tert-butyl-4-methylphenol. Analysis of the molecular geometry of 2,4,6-tri(..cap alpha..,..cap alpha..-dimethylbenzyl)phenol shows that the most reactive of the three exocyclic C-C bonds of the phenol ring is the bond at the para position to the hydroxyl group.
